Bulgaria have good players and England will have a very hard time against them in Friday's Euro 2012, England's manager Fabio Capello declared in Sofia.
The English national football team arrived in the Bulgarian capital Thursday afternoon, with Capello speaking before Bulgarian and UK journalists at the Kempinski Hotel in Sofia.
"I saw Bulgaria's last two matches against Switzerland and Montenegro and they played very well there. They have strong players. I expect a tough match. We need to watch out for Bulgaria's counter-attacks," Capello warned.
He stressed a win was crucial for his team in Sofia in order not to fall behind from Montenegro in the quest for the first spot in Euro 2012 qualifying group G.
Capello said he respected all of England's opponents but that he feared no one.
Earlier this week, England's head coach Fabio Capello warned against underestimating Bulgaria ahead of the Euro 2012 qualifier on Friday, September 2.
Capello said Monday he wanted to get six points from England's Euro 2012 qualifiers in September against Bulgaria and Wales.
His goal is to make sure England's final qualifier in Montenegro on October 7 does not turn into a must-win occasion. England are currently level on points with Montenegro at the head of Group G.
However, England have two matches during the forthcoming internationals, and Montenegro only have one.
The Guardian says that "the omens are good" for England who have not lost in nine previous meetings with Bulgaria. The paper reminds the English crushed Bulgaria 4:0 at Wembley in September 2010 in a Euro 2012 qualifier.
Bulgaria are fourth out of 5 teams in qualifying Group G for the Euro 2012 championship after poor performances throughout the past year.
England are first with 11 points, followed by Montenegro, also with 11. Switzerland are third with 5 points – as many as Bulgaria – and Wales are 5th with 0 points.
With two matches left at home against England in September and Wales in October, Bulgaria have only theoretical chances to make it to the second spot in Group G that can give them the opportunity to fight for a place at Euro 2012.
